As the real estate market continues its upward trend across the country, it is not surprising to hear that single family homes are selling much more quickly. According to the California Association of Realtors, homes sold at an average 95 Days on Market, compared to 107 Days on Market. In the city of San Juan Capistrano where my office is based, homes sold at an average 66 Days on Market in November 2012, compared to 77 Days on Market the year earlier. With all this said, some markets are hotter than others but two things are very clear: 1) It's a very good time to be a seller with prices up sharply and homes selling quickly, 2) It's also a good time to a buyer with interest rates at record lows but competition to buy is intense and buyers need to work with a very good real estate agent and be prepared to move FAST!
